When I played Megalith at E3, it was a little bit of a revelation for me. Intuitively I knew that hero shooter-style games, or rather action games that pit players against each other in an arena and let them pick from a host of characters each with vastly different powers, would be a good fit for VR. But I’d never tried one. Now with Conjure Strike, another team-based VR shooter with objective-based game modes, I’m convinced this style of VR game is here to stay.
The small development team at The Strike Force have done a great job of boiling down the core principles of what makes games like Overwatch and Paladins and even MOBAs such as League of Legends or Dota 2 so fun and popular and then doubled down on those ideas for Conjure Strike.
